Latest Patents
One of Bryan Haas's latest patents is titled "Methods and apparatuses for downconverting high frequency subbands and isolating signals therein." This invention involves a sophisticated system that includes a controller, a signal generator, an optical source, a dual-drive Mach-Zehnder modulator (DDMZM), a photodetector, and a dechipping/image (DI) rejector. The system is designed to downconvert high-frequency subbands to a lower frequency band while recovering signals of interest. The controller outputs chipping frequencies to the signal generator, which generates local oscillator tones shifted by the respective chipping frequencies. The optical source outputs an optical signal to the DDMZM, which modulates the input signal and local oscillator tones to produce a combined output signal.
Another notable patent by Haas is "Microwave photonic links and methods of forming the same." This invention also utilizes a dual-drive Mach-Zehnder modulator (DDMZM) to receive a continuous wavelength optical signal, an input microwave signal, and local oscillator tones. The DDMZM modulates these signals to create an output optical signal that is optimized for specific applications in microwave photonics.
